Subject: [RFC PATCH 6/9] x86/apic: Introduce Remote Action Request Operations

RAR TLB flushing is started by sending a command to the APIC.
This patch adds Remote Action Request commands.

diff --git a/arch/x86/include/asm/apicdef.h b/arch/x86/include/asm/apicdef.h
index 094106b6a538..b152d45af91a 100644
--- a/arch/x86/include/asm/apicdef.h
+++ b/arch/x86/include/asm/apicdef.h
@@ -92,6 +92,7 @@
#define APIC_DM_LOWEST 0x00100
#define APIC_DM_SMI 0x00200
#define APIC_DM_REMRD 0x00300
+#define APIC_DM_RAR 0x00300
#define APIC_DM_NMI 0x00400
#define APIC_DM_INIT 0x00500
#define APIC_DM_STARTUP 0x00600
diff --git a/arch/x86/include/asm/irq_vectors.h b/arch/x86/include/asm/irq_vectors.h
index 47051871b436..c417b0015304 100644
--- a/arch/x86/include/asm/irq_vectors.h
+++ b/arch/x86/include/asm/irq_vectors.h
@@ -103,6 +103,11 @@
*/
#define POSTED_MSI_NOTIFICATION_VECTOR 0xeb
+/*
+ * RAR (remote action request) TLB flush
+ */
+#define RAR_VECTOR 0xe0
+
#define NR_VECTORS 256
#ifdef CONFIG_X86_LOCAL_APIC
diff --git a/arch/x86/include/asm/smp.h b/arch/x86/include/asm/smp.h
index 0c1c68039d6f..1ab9f5fcac8a 100644
--- a/arch/x86/include/asm/smp.h
+++ b/arch/x86/include/asm/smp.h
@@ -40,6 +40,9 @@ struct smp_ops {
void (*send_call_func_ipi)(const struct cpumask *mask);
void (*send_call_func_single_ipi)(int cpu);
+
+ void (*send_rar_ipi)(const struct cpumask *mask);
+ void (*send_rar_single_ipi)(int cpu);
};
/* Globals due to paravirt */
@@ -100,6 +103,16 @@ static inline void arch_send_call_function_ipi_mask(const struct cpumask *mask)
smp_ops.send_call_func_ipi(mask);
}
+static inline void arch_send_rar_single_ipi(int cpu)
+{
+ smp_ops.send_rar_single_ipi(cpu);
+}
+
+static inline void arch_send_rar_ipi_mask(const struct cpumask *mask)
+{
+ smp_ops.send_rar_ipi(mask);
+}
+
void cpu_disable_common(void);
void native_smp_prepare_boot_cpu(void);
void smp_prepare_cpus_common(void);
@@ -120,6 +133,8 @@ void __noreturn mwait_play_dead(unsigned int eax_hint);
void native_smp_send_reschedule(int cpu);
void native_send_call_func_ipi(const struct cpumask *mask);
void native_send_call_func_single_ipi(int cpu);
+void native_send_rar_ipi(const struct cpumask *mask);
+void native_send_rar_single_ipi(int cpu);
asmlinkage __visible void smp_reboot_interrupt(void);
__visible void smp_reschedule_interrupt(struct pt_regs *regs);
diff --git a/arch/x86/kernel/apic/ipi.c b/arch/x86/kernel/apic/ipi.c
index 98a57cb4aa86..e5e9fc08f86c 100644
--- a/arch/x86/kernel/apic/ipi.c
+++ b/arch/x86/kernel/apic/ipi.c
@@ -79,7 +79,7 @@ void native_send_call_func_single_ipi(int cpu)
__apic_send_IPI(cpu, CALL_FUNCTION_SINGLE_VECTOR);
}
-void native_send_call_func_ipi(const struct cpumask *mask)
+static void do_native_send_ipi(const struct cpumask *mask, int vector)
{
if (static_branch_likely(&apic_use_ipi_shorthand)) {
unsigned int cpu = smp_processor_id();
@@ -88,14 +88,19 @@ void native_send_call_func_ipi(const struct cpumask *mask)
goto sendmask;
if (cpumask_test_cpu(cpu, mask))
- __apic_send_IPI_all(CALL_FUNCTION_VECTOR);
+ __apic_send_IPI_all(vector);
else if (num_online_cpus() > 1)
- __apic_send_IPI_allbutself(CALL_FUNCTION_VECTOR);
+ __apic_send_IPI_allbutself(vector);
return;
}
sendmask:
- __apic_send_IPI_mask(mask, CALL_FUNCTION_VECTOR);
+ __apic_send_IPI_mask(mask, vector);
+}
+
+void native_send_call_func_ipi(const struct cpumask *mask)
+{
+ do_native_send_ipi(mask, CALL_FUNCTION_VECTOR);
}
void apic_send_nmi_to_offline_cpu(unsigned int cpu)
@@ -106,6 +111,16 @@ void apic_send_nmi_to_offline_cpu(unsigned int cpu)
return;
apic->send_IPI(cpu, NMI_VECTOR);
}
+
+void native_send_rar_single_ipi(int cpu)
+{
+ apic->send_IPI_mask(cpumask_of(cpu), RAR_VECTOR);
+}
+
+void native_send_rar_ipi(const struct cpumask *mask)
+{
+ do_native_send_ipi(mask, RAR_VECTOR);
+}
#endif /* CONFIG_SMP */
static inline int __prepare_ICR2(unsigned int mask)
diff --git a/arch/x86/kernel/apic/local.h b/arch/x86/kernel/apic/local.h
index bdcf609eb283..833669174267 100644
--- a/arch/x86/kernel/apic/local.h
+++ b/arch/x86/kernel/apic/local.h
@@ -38,6 +38,9 @@ static inline unsigned int __prepare_ICR(unsigned int shortcut, int vector,
case NMI_VECTOR:
icr |= APIC_DM_NMI;
break;
+ case RAR_VECTOR:
+ icr |= APIC_DM_RAR;
+ break;
}
return icr;
}
diff --git a/arch/x86/kernel/smp.c b/arch/x86/kernel/smp.c
index 18266cc3d98c..2c51ed6aaf03 100644
--- a/arch/x86/kernel/smp.c
+++ b/arch/x86/kernel/smp.c
@@ -297,5 +297,8 @@ struct smp_ops smp_ops = {
.send_call_func_ipi = native_send_call_func_ipi,
.send_call_func_single_ipi = native_send_call_func_single_ipi,
+
+ .send_rar_ipi = native_send_rar_ipi,
+ .send_rar_single_ipi = native_send_rar_single_ipi,
};
E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(smp_ops);
